Transaction a98c77b4b41878db20b23665595cbd9b5c580416854271aa2e15580b34ad0581

12 Input
1 Outputs
  • a98c77b4b41878db20b23665595cbd9b5c580416854271aa2e15580b34ad0581:0
  • value  4699514
    address  36rBP93aHfZyxm1e4bhQ4zbXiAJWDPnTmS